- Abstract
- This work presents a new circuit topology and its digital control scheme of the half-bridge resonant inverter. As the proposed half-bridge inverter can be operated in the load-freewheeling modes, pulse width modulation (PWM) control method can be used for the output power control. The proposed half-bridge inverter should keep unity output displacement factor under the load-impedance varying conditions, if a new PWM control scheme based on the resonant frequency tracking algorithm is adopted. In this paper, the operation principle, electrical characteristics, and detailed digital control scheme of the proposed half-bridge resonant inverter are described. Experimental results of the prototype experimental setup to verify the validity of the proposed half-bridge resonant inverter are presented and discussed.
